Incident Narrative
An employee fell four to five feet off an extension ladder resulting in a broken lower right leg.
Incident Summary
On April 4, 2017, a worker at Baker DC LLC in WASHINGTON, DISTRICT OF COLUMBIA suffered fractures to the lower leg(s). The incident was classified as other fall to lower level less than 6 feet, with extension ladders identified as the source of injury. The worker was hospitalized.
